Abstract

L'invention porte sur un système de saisie de la trajectoire des coordonnées d'un stylet (130) se déplaçant sur une surface de taille et forme arbitraires. Un premier récepteur (110) monté sur la surface (150) reçoit un premier faisceau lumineux du stylet (130). Un deuxième récepteur (120) également monté sur la surface (150) reçoit un deuxième faisceau lumineux du stylet (130). Le stylet (130) émet plusieurs cônes de lumière divergents comprenant le premier et le deuxième faisceau lumineux à partir d'une source intérieure de lumière, ou émet au moins un cône de lumière divergent comprenant les faisceaux lumineux par réflexion d'au moins une source de lumière divergente qui projette au moins un cône de lumière divergente sur la surface. Le premier faisceau lumineux fait un premier angle par rapport à un système de coordonnées cartésiennes placé sur la surface (150) et le deuxième faisceau lumineux fait un deuxième angle par rapport à ce même système de coordonnées. Le premier récepteur (110) détermine le premier angle, et le deuxième récepteur (120) détermine le deuxième angle. Un processeur (140) détermine la position du stylet (130) en fonction de ces deux angles et des emplacements respectifs du premier et du deuxième récepteur (110, 120) à l'intérieur du système de coordonnées cartésiennes.
